Sex education and overpopulation

  Sex education is high quality teaching and learning about a broad variety of topics related to sex and sexuality, exploring values and beliefs about those topics and gaining the skills that are needed to navigate relationships and manage one’s own sexual health. Sex education may take place in schools, in community settings, or online. Sex education helps people gain the information, skills and motivation to make healthy decisions about sex and sexuality.
